Dishwasher Symptoms Worth Mentioning

Weak cleaning can come from spray arms, filters, water temperature, fill volume, or circulation pump problems. If the appliance still works partly, mention which functions still operate and which ones fail.

Dishes still dirty

Weak cleaning can come from spray arms, filters, water temperature, fill volume, or circulation pump problems.

Dishwasher not draining

Standing water may involve the drain pump, filter, hose path, disposal connection, or control sequence.

Noise and error codes

A technician can inspect pumps, motors, obstructions, sensors, and electronic controls.

What To Mention After The Main Symptom

Say whether the appliance failed completely or still performs part of the job before the symptom appears. If there is a display, write the message down before clearing it so the timing and exact wording are not lost. Avoid repeated resets when the same warning returns, since the pattern itself can be useful during diagnosis. The more specific the symptom timeline is, the easier it is to discuss realistic appointment options.
